Parliamentary Service New Zealand – Wellington Central, North Island Our Customer Service team are the face of Parliament! They have a very clear and easy to understand mission, that is to provide rich and meaningful connections between the public and parliament. We are not just the face of Parliament at our reception desks, and the voice of Parliament on the phone, but we are also the engine room that works behind the scenes to support our teams to provide a high-level of customer service for all our internal and external customers. No two days are ever the same and you'll get a chance to engage with a wide variance of people from all walks of life. The role is an equal mix of face-to-face customer service, and behind the scenes administration to support our systems and other teams to do their work. We're entering an exciting time for our Customer Service Centre; Election 2026 on the horizon and a new building soon opening, we’re looking for talented people to join us. Tō kete | What You’ll Bring: We're looking for someone who's passionate about people, is motivated to provide an exceptional customer experience every time and can work within our collaborative and busy team. We're also looking for: The ability to communicate effectively with a wide range of people. A drive to provide warm, welcoming, excellent customer service to all. Resilience under pressure and an ability to deal with difficult interactions. An ability to adapt and learn quickly, and a positive approach to change. Problem solving and organisational skills. Confidence using MS office suite. Flexibility within your role and a 'can-do' attitude. These opportunities include a full-time fixed-term role until November 2026, a full-time fixed term position until March 2027, and the option to join our casual Customer Service Support pool for future work. Please state in your application which type of role you’re interested in. These roles work Monday – Friday between the hours of 8am – 6pm.
